PeerContact.GetApplications Methode

Definition

Ruft die PeerApplication Objekte ab, die vom Remote-Peer im lokalen Cache registriert wurden.

Überlädt

Name Beschreibung
GetApplications()

Ruft die PeerApplication Objekte ab, die vom Remote-Peer im lokalen Cache registriert wurden.

GetApplications(Guid)

Ruft die Auflistung von PeerApplication Objekten mit dem angegebenen Guid aus dem lokalen Cache ab.

GetApplications(PeerEndPoint)

Ruft das PeerApplicationCollection zugeordnete mit der angegebenen PeerEndPoint.

GetApplications(PeerEndPoint, Guid)

Ruft das PeerApplicationCollection zugeordnete mit der angegebenen PeerEndPoint.

Hinweise

Diese Funktionalität wird nur für die PeerContact Klasse verfügbar gemacht. Diese Funktionalität wird aus Sicherheitsgründen nicht für einen anderen Peertyp verfügbar gemacht.

GetApplications()

Ruft die PeerApplication Objekte ab, die vom Remote-Peer im lokalen Cache registriert wurden.

public:
 System::Net::PeerToPeer::Collaboration::PeerApplicationCollection ^ GetApplications();
[System.Security.SecurityCritical]
public System.Net.PeerToPeer.Collaboration.PeerApplicationCollection GetApplications();
[<System.Security.SecurityCritical>]
member this.GetApplications : unit -> System.Net.PeerToPeer.Collaboration.PeerApplicationCollection
Public Function GetApplications () As PeerApplicationCollection

Gibt zurück

Der PeerApplicationCollection aus dem lokalen Cache. Wenn zugeordnete Anwendungen für die PeerEndPointNicht gefunden werden, wird eine Sammlung von Größe Null (0) zurückgegeben.

Attribute

Ausnahmen

  • Der anrufde Peer wird nicht abonniert.PeerEndPoint

  • Der aufrufende Peer hat die RefreshData() Methode noch nicht aufgerufen.

Der Vorgang kann nicht abgeschlossen werden GetApplications() .

Hinweise

Wenn der aufrufende Peer nicht mit der PeerContact angegebenen PeerEndPointRefreshData Methode verknüpft ist, muss vor dem Aufrufen dieser Methode aufgerufen werden.

Während der Aufrufer nicht erforderlich ist, sich bei der Infrastruktur für die Zusammenarbeit anzumelden, damit diese Methode erfolgreich abgeschlossen werden kann, muss ein erfolgreicher Aufruf oder RefreshData eine der Subscribe Methoden abgeschlossen sein, während der Aufrufer zuvor angemeldet war.

Diese Funktionalität wird nur für die PeerContact Klasse verfügbar gemacht. Diese Funktionalität wird aus Sicherheitsgründen nicht für einen anderen Peertyp verfügbar gemacht.

Hinweise für Aufrufer

Zum Aufrufen dieser Methode ist eine PermissionState von Unrestricted. Dieser Zustand wird erstellt, wenn die Peerzusammenarbeitssitzung beginnt.

Gilt für:

GetApplications(Guid)

Ruft die Auflistung von PeerApplication Objekten mit dem angegebenen Guid aus dem lokalen Cache ab.

public:
 System::Net::PeerToPeer::Collaboration::PeerApplicationCollection ^ GetApplications(Guid applicationId);
[System.Security.SecurityCritical]
public System.Net.PeerToPeer.Collaboration.PeerApplicationCollection GetApplications(Guid applicationId);
[<System.Security.SecurityCritical>]
member this.GetApplications : Guid -> System.Net.PeerToPeer.Collaboration.PeerApplicationCollection
Public Function GetApplications (applicationId As Guid) As PeerApplicationCollection

Parameter

applicationId
Guid

Die Guid peer-Anwendung, die abgerufen werden soll.

Gibt zurück

Der PeerApplicationCollection aus dem lokalen Cache. Wenn keine Anwendungen mit dem angegebenen applicationIdgefunden werden, wird eine Sammlung von Größe Null (0) zurückgegeben.

Attribute

Ausnahmen

  • Der anrufde Peer wird nicht abonniert.PeerEndPoint

  • Der aufrufende Peer hat die RefreshData() Methode noch nicht aufgerufen.

Der Vorgang kann nicht abgeschlossen werden GetApplications() .

Hinweise

Wenn der aufrufende Peer nicht mit der PeerContact angegebenen PeerEndPointRefreshData Methode verknüpft ist, muss vor dem Aufrufen dieser Methode aufgerufen werden.

Während der Aufrufer nicht erforderlich ist, sich bei der Infrastruktur für die Zusammenarbeit anzumelden, damit diese Methode erfolgreich abgeschlossen werden kann, muss ein erfolgreicher Aufruf oder RefreshData eine der Subscribe Methoden abgeschlossen sein, während der Aufrufer zuvor angemeldet war.

Diese Funktionalität wird nur für die PeerContact Klasse verfügbar gemacht. Diese Funktionalität wird aus Sicherheitsgründen nicht für einen anderen Peertyp verfügbar gemacht.

Hinweise für Aufrufer

Zum Aufrufen dieser Methode ist eine PermissionState von Unrestricted. Dieser Zustand wird erstellt, wenn die Peerzusammenarbeitssitzung beginnt.

Weitere Informationen

Gilt für:

GetApplications(PeerEndPoint)

Ruft das PeerApplicationCollection zugeordnete mit der angegebenen PeerEndPoint.

public:
 System::Net::PeerToPeer::Collaboration::PeerApplicationCollection ^ GetApplications(System::Net::PeerToPeer::Collaboration::PeerEndPoint ^ peerEndPoint);
[System.Security.SecurityCritical]
public System.Net.PeerToPeer.Collaboration.PeerApplicationCollection GetApplications(System.Net.PeerToPeer.Collaboration.PeerEndPoint peerEndPoint);
[<System.Security.SecurityCritical>]
member this.GetApplications : System.Net.PeerToPeer.Collaboration.PeerEndPoint -> System.Net.PeerToPeer.Collaboration.PeerApplicationCollection
Public Function GetApplications (peerEndPoint As PeerEndPoint) As PeerApplicationCollection

Parameter

peerEndPoint
PeerEndPoint

Enthält Endpunktinformationen, die der PeerContact.

Gibt zurück

The PeerApplicationCollection associated with the specified PeerEndPoint. Wenn Anwendungen nicht dem angegebenen PeerEndPointzugeordnet sind, wird eine Sammlung von Größe Null (0) zurückgegeben.

Attribute

Ausnahmen

PeerEndPoint darf nicht null sein.

  • Der anrufde Peer wird nicht abonniert.PeerEndPoint

  • Der aufrufende Peer hat die RefreshData() Methode noch nicht aufgerufen.

Der Vorgang kann nicht abgeschlossen werden GetApplications() .

Hinweise

Wenn der aufrufende Peer nicht mit der PeerContact angegebenen PeerEndPointRefreshData Methode verknüpft ist, muss vor dem Aufrufen dieser Methode aufgerufen werden.

Während der Aufrufer nicht erforderlich ist, sich bei der Infrastruktur für die Zusammenarbeit anzumelden, damit diese Methode erfolgreich abgeschlossen werden kann, muss ein erfolgreicher Aufruf oder RefreshData eine der Subscribe Methoden abgeschlossen sein, während der Aufrufer zuvor angemeldet war.

Diese Funktionalität wird nur für die PeerContact Klasse verfügbar gemacht. Diese Funktionalität wird aus Sicherheitsgründen nicht für einen anderen Peertyp verfügbar gemacht.

Hinweise für Aufrufer

Zum Aufrufen dieser Methode ist eine PermissionState von Unrestricted. Dieser Zustand wird erstellt, wenn die Peerzusammenarbeitssitzung beginnt.

Weitere Informationen

Gilt für:

GetApplications(PeerEndPoint, Guid)

Ruft das PeerApplicationCollection zugeordnete mit der angegebenen PeerEndPoint.

public:
 System::Net::PeerToPeer::Collaboration::PeerApplicationCollection ^ GetApplications(System::Net::PeerToPeer::Collaboration::PeerEndPoint ^ peerEndPoint, Guid applicationId);
[System.Security.SecurityCritical]
public System.Net.PeerToPeer.Collaboration.PeerApplicationCollection GetApplications(System.Net.PeerToPeer.Collaboration.PeerEndPoint peerEndPoint, Guid applicationId);
[<System.Security.SecurityCritical>]
member this.GetApplications : System.Net.PeerToPeer.Collaboration.PeerEndPoint * Guid -> System.Net.PeerToPeer.Collaboration.PeerApplicationCollection
Public Function GetApplications (peerEndPoint As PeerEndPoint, applicationId As Guid) As PeerApplicationCollection

Parameter

peerEndPoint
PeerEndPoint

Der Endpunkt, der der PeerApplicationCollection.

applicationId
Guid

Enthält Anwendungsinformationen, die der PeerContact.

Gibt zurück

Die Auflistung von PeerApplication Objekten, die der PeerEndPoint.

Wenn von der ID identifizierte Anwendungen für den PeerEndPointEndpunkt nicht gefunden werden oder die ID für den Endpunkt ungültig ist oder ungültig ist null , wird eine Sammlung der Größe Null (0) zurückgegeben.

Attribute

Ausnahmen

PeerEndPoint darf nicht null sein.

  • Der anrufde Peer wird nicht abonniert.PeerEndPoint

  • Der aufrufende Peer hat die RefreshData() Methode noch nicht aufgerufen.

Der Vorgang kann nicht abgeschlossen werden GetApplications() .

Hinweise

Wenn der aufrufende Peer nicht mit der PeerContact angegebenen PeerEndPointRefreshData Methode verknüpft ist, muss vor dem Aufrufen dieser Methode aufgerufen werden.

Während der Aufrufer nicht erforderlich ist, sich bei der Infrastruktur für die Zusammenarbeit anzumelden, damit diese Methode erfolgreich abgeschlossen werden kann, muss ein erfolgreicher Aufruf oder RefreshData eine der Subscribe Methoden abgeschlossen sein, während der Aufrufer zuvor angemeldet war.

Diese Funktionalität wird nur für die PeerContact Klasse verfügbar gemacht. Diese Funktionalität wird aus Sicherheitsgründen nicht für einen anderen Peertyp verfügbar gemacht.

Hinweise für Aufrufer

Zum Aufrufen dieser Methode ist eine PermissionState von Unrestricted. Dieser Zustand wird erstellt, wenn die Peerzusammenarbeitssitzung beginnt.

Weitere Informationen

Gilt für: